Planning a baby shower can be both exciting and overwhelming. When organizing an event like this, consider themes that resonate with the parents-to-be, such as whimsical, floral, or vintage styles. Incorporate personalized touches, like custom baby shower invitations and decorations that reflect the parents' personalities. Additionally, select meaningful games that engage guests and create lasting memories. You might include baby shower bingo, a diaper raffle, or advice cards for parents. Food choices are also crucial; think about a menu that accommodates all dietary preferences, including vegetarian or gluten-free options. Sweet treats like cupcakes and a beautifully designed cake can be the highlight of the dessert table. Involving family and friends in preparations can enhance the joyous atmosphere and make the day even more special. Don’t forget to capture these precious moments on camera or hire a photographer to document the celebrations. After the shower, create a keepsake album for the family to cherish these memories for years to come.
